| def SPI(**spi_args):
 | |
|     """
 | |
|     Returns an SPI interface, for the specified SPI *port* and *device*, or for
 | |
|     the specified pins (*clock_pin*, *mosi_pin*, *miso_pin*, and *select_pin*).
 | |
|     Only one of the schemes can be used; attempting to mix *port* and *device*
 | |
|     with pin numbers will raise :exc:`SPIBadArgs`.
 | |
| 
 | |
|     If the pins specified match the hardware SPI pins (clock on GPIO11, MOSI on
 | |
|     GPIO10, MISO on GPIO9, and chip select on GPIO8 or GPIO7), and the spidev
 | |
|     module can be imported, a :class:`SPIHardwareInterface` instance will be
 | |
|     returned. Otherwise, a :class:`SPISoftwareInterface` will be returned which
 | |
|     will use simple bit-banging to communicate.
 | |
| 
 | |
|     Both interfaces have the same API, support clock polarity and phase
 | |
|     attributes, and can handle half and full duplex communications, but the
 | |
|     hardware interface is significantly faster (though for many things this
 | |
|     doesn't matter).
 | |
| 
 | |
|     Finally, the *shared* keyword argument specifies whether the resulting
 | |
|     SPI interface can be repeatedly created and used by multiple devices
 | |
|     (useful with multi-channel devices like numerous ADCs).
 | |
|     """
